Our in-screed heating cable is a series-type, twin conductor heating cable with a 2.5m cold lead on one side for power connection.
The heating conductor is enclosed in an initial high temperature insulation layer, which is itself wrapped in a protective metal shielding, before being encased in a final Polyolefin outer sheath. The final diameter of the heating cable is 5mm.
The cold lead junctions are prefabricated and rigorously tested in a controlled factory environment to ensure reliability.
- Application - In-screed floor heating in domestic and commercial buildings.
- Standard - Meets all test requirements of IEC 60800.
- Cost-effective - Underfloor heating delivers heat directly where it's needed, ensuring optimal heat efficiency and minimal energy loss.
- Flexibility - Can be laid to heat any layout.
- Safety - Connection to RCD safety switches guarantees protection and safety.
- Wattage - 17W/m.
- Range - Pre-fabricated lengths from 10m to 183m.
- Target cable spacing - 100mm to achieve a heat output of 170W/m².
- Cold lead length - 2.5mm
- Warranty - 15 Years.

FAQ
How thick should the screed layer be for electric in-screed heating?
The screed layer for electric in-screed heating should typically be around 25-40mm thick. This thickness ensures that the cables are properly covered and that the heat is distributed evenly across the floor. Note where screed layers exceed 40mm, an insulated tile backer board should be used to restrict heat losses into the floor below.
Do I need to insulate beneath the screed for better performance?
Yes, it is highly recommended to install insulation beneath the screed layer to maximise the efficiency of the in-screed heating system. Insulation helps to direct the heat upwards into the room rather than allowing it to dissipate downward, making the system more energy-efficient and cost-effective.
How long does it take for in-screed underfloor heating to warm up?
Electric in-screed heating systems typically take a little longer to warm up compared to direct under tile heating systems, as the screed layer must absorb and gradually release the heat. However, once the screed is heated, it retains warmth for an extended period, providing consistent comfort throughout the day.
Is electric in-screed underfloor heating suitable for wet areas like bathrooms?
Yes, electric in-screed heating can be installed in wet areas like bathrooms, provided the system is correctly installed according to guidelines. It helps prevent moisture buildup, providing a comfortable and warm environment, especially during cold weather.
How do I control the temperature of my in-screed heating system?
Temperature control is typically managed through a programmable thermostat, which allows you to set your desired temperature and schedule heating cycles. Some systems also offer smart controls, allowing you to adjust settings remotely via an app for added convenience and efficiency.
